A quality control of a virtual simulation system including an inverse DRR software

Abstract

The aim of this work was to define different quality control procedures so as to verify our virtual simulation system (1 Scanner PQ 5000, 2 virtual simulation system AcQSim/Picker). The Fox Chase center has already presented a phantom for the Picker simulation system in [1]. However, this phantom although interesting was considered by our team not sufficient to verify all the aspects of the system. More complete quality controls are presented in [2–4]. In this work, we present a complete procedure with new controls (see table 1) based on a cube phantom.
